Le format des fichiers
Résumé
IGES, ou Initial Graphics Exchange Specification, est un format de fichiers conçu pour faciliter l’échange de données de conception entre différentes applications CAD (Computer-Aided Design). Développé au début des années 1980 par les Forces aériennes des États-Unis et plus tard adopté comme une norme nationale américaine, IGE est devenu une pierre angulaire pour partager des dessins d’ingénierie détaillés et des modèles à travers diverses industries. Que vous travaillez sur des conceptions mécaniques traditionnelles ou des processus de fabrication avancés, IgES s’assure que vos données CAD restent accessibles et interopérables.
Les développeurs et les utilisateurs techniques dépendent souvent de l’IGES parce qu’il soutient les informations de conception 2D et 3D, ce qui le rend polyvalent pour un large éventail d’applications, des filets simples à des modèles solides complexes. son adoption répandue signifie que vous pouvez facilement trouver des outils logiciels et des bibliothèques pour travailler avec les fichiers IGES dans différents systèmes d’exploitation.
Caratteristiche principali
- Exchange de données versatile: Il prend en charge les données CAD 2D et 3D.
- Compliance standard: Adhère aux normes industrielles établies pour la compatibilité.
- ** Représentation détaillée de l’entité** : permet une définition précise des éléments géométriques tels que les lignes, les arcs et les surfaces.
- Support à la bibliothèque extensive: Nombre d’APIs et de librairies disponibles pour l’accès logiciel.
- Cross-Platform Compatibility: fonctionne sans fil sur différents systèmes d’exploitation.
spécifications techniques
Formation Structure
Les fichiers IGES sont enregistrés dans le format texte ASCII. Cela signifie que vous pouvez les ouvrir avec n’importe quel éditeur de texte pour voir leur contenu, bien que le logiciel spécialisé est généralement utilisé pour l’édition ou la visualisation des données efficacement.
Les composants de base
Sections des fichiers
Les fichiers IGES sont divisés en cinq sections distinctes:
- Start (S) : Il contient des métadonnées de base sur le fichier, telles que son nom et sa source.
- Global (G) : Il contient des données de pré-processeur et des délimitants pour la section Data Parameter.
- Data Entry (D): Liste des entités qui définissent les éléments géométriques dans le design.
- Data de paramètre (PD) : Il fournit des paramètres détaillés pour chaque entité énumérée dans la section Data Entry.
- Terminate (T) : marque la fin du fichier.
Propriétés entités
Chaque entité dans un fichier IGES a des propriétés spécifiques, y compris:
| Nom de champ | Description |
|---|---|
| * Type d’entité * | Identifie le type d’élément géométrique (par exemple, ligne, arc). |
| * Le PD Pointer* | Points à l’emplacement dans la section Données Paramètres où les données de cette entité sont stockées. |
| « Structure » | Il indique s’il y a une référence à une autre entité de définition ou non. |
| * Modèle de la ligne * | Il spécifie le modèle de ligne utilisé lors de la rendue de l’entité (par exemple, solide, déchiré). |
| * Le niveau et la vue * | Définit les niveaux de visibilité et les options de visualisation pour l’entité. |
| * Matrix de transformation * | Références à une matrice de transformation si des transformations sont appliquées à l’entité. |
| ** Label Affichage Associativité** | Points à une entité associative qui définit comment les étiquettes doivent être affichées. |
| * Numéro de statut * | Il contient des drapeaux indiquant le statut, la dépendance et l’utilisation de l’entité. |
| * Numéro de séquence * | Un identifiant unique pour chaque entité dans le fichier. |
| * Numéro de poids de ligne * | Il spécifie la densité des lignes lors de l’affichage d’une entité. |
| * Numéro de couleur * | Il détermine la couleur utilisée pour rendre l’entité. |
| * Numéro de ligne de paramètre* | Il indique combien de lignes dans la section Données Paramètres sont consacrées aux données de cette entité. |
| * Numéro de formulaire * | Définir la forme ou la représentation de l’entité. |
| * Les champs réservés * | Il n’est pas utilisé actuellement mais réservé à l’utilisation future. |
| ** Étiquette de l’entité et numéro de souscription** | Ensemble, ces champs fournissent un identifiant unique pour chaque entité dans le fichier. |
Normes et compatibilité
IGES adhère à la norme nationale américaine X3.124-1985 (R1996) et est largement soutenu sur diverses plateformes de logiciels CAD telles que Autodesk Inventor et SolidWorks.
Histoire et évolution
IGES a été développé pour la première fois au début des années 1980 par les Forces aériennes des États-Unis pour normaliser l’échange de graphiques d’ingénierie entre différents systèmes. Sa sortie initiale a pour but de résoudre les problèmes d’interopérabilité parmi les différentes applications CAD utilisées dans le secteur de la défense. Au fil du temps, l’IGES est mis à jour et raffiné par plusieurs révisions pour incorporer de nouvelles fonctionnalités et améliorer la compatibilité avec les normes évoluantes.
Travailler avec IGES Files
Ouverture des fichiers IGES
Les fichiers IGES peuvent être ouverts en utilisant des logiciels spécialisés comme Autodesk Inventor, SolidWorks, ou des outils gratuits comme CADSoftTools ABViewer. Ces applications sont disponibles sur les plateformes Windows, macOS et Linux, ce qui garantit une large accessibilité à travers différents systèmes d’exploitation.
Conversion des fichiers IGES
Les scénarios de conversion communs comprennent la traduction des données IGES dans d’autres formats tels que STEP (Standard for the Exchange of Product Model Data) ou DXF (Drawing Interchange Format). L’approche implique généralement l’utilisation d’outils logiciels dédiés qui soutiennent les conversions bidirectionnelles entre ces format.
Créer des fichiers IGES
Les fichiers IGES sont généralement créés dans les applications CAD conçues pour les tâches d’ingénierie et de fabrication. logiciels tels que Autodesk Inventor ou SolidWorks incluent une fonctionnalité intégrée pour exporter des concepts dans le format IGEs, ce qui permet de générer facilement des ficher IGE conformes directement de votre environnement de conception.
Casi d’uso comuni
- Interopérabilité à travers les systèmes CAD: Lorsque vous avez besoin de partager des modèles 3D détaillés entre différentes plateformes de logiciels CAD.
- Collaboration de fabrication et d’ingénierie: pour l’échange de dessins techniques précises et de modèles solides entre les membres de l’équipe ou les partenaires en utilisant divers outils.
- Legacy Data Migration: Conversion de fichiers IGES plus anciens dans des formats plus modernes tels que STEP pour une gestion améliorée des données et la compatibilité avec les systèmes contemporains.
Avantages & Limitations
Les avantages:
- Compatibilité large: Il prend en charge un large éventail de logiciels CAD et de systèmes d’exploitation.
- ** Représentation détaillée de l’entité**: permet une définition précise des éléments géométriques, assurant un échange de données précis.
- Compliance standard: Adhère aux normes industrielles établies pour l’interopérabilité.
Les limites:
- Structure complexe: La structure détaillée peut être difficile pour les débutants de comprendre et de travailler avec.
- Support limité pour les fonctionnalités avancées: Certaines fonctions CAD modernes peuvent ne pas être complètement supportées dans IGES, ce qui nécessite des étapes de traitement supplémentaires lors de l’échange de données.
Les ressources de développeur
La programmation avec les fichiers IGES est soutenue par l’intermédiaire de différentes API et bibliothèques. exemples de code et guides d’application seront bientôt ajoutés.
Questions fréquentes posées
** Quel logiciel puis-je utiliser pour ouvrir les fichiers IGES ?**
Vous pouvez utiliser des applications CAD spécialisées comme Autodesk Inventor ou des outils gratuits comme ABViewer pour afficher les fichiers IGES.
Comment puis-je convertir un fichier IGES dans un autre format?
Les scénarios de conversion communs impliquent l’utilisation de logiciels dédiés qui soutiennent les conversions bidirectionnelles entre IGES et des formats tels que STEP ou DXF.
** Est-ce que IGES est compatible avec les systèmes CAD modernes ?**
Oui, IGES est largement soutenu sur diverses plateformes CAD modernes mais peut nécessiter un traitement supplémentaire pour les fonctionnalités avancées qui ne sont pas complètement couvertes par la norme.